from openpyxl import load_workbook | |
from openpyxl import Workbook | |
import os | |
# Read data from active worksheet and return it as a list | |
def reader(file): | |
global path | |
abs_file = os.path.join(path, file) | |
wb_sheet = load_workbook(abs_file).active | |
rows = [] | |
# min_row is set to 2, ignore the first row which contains headers | |
for row in wb_sheet.iter_rows(min_row=2): | |
row_data = [] | |
for cell in row: | |
row_data.append(cell.value) | |
rows.append(row_data) | |
return rows | |
# You can replace these with your own headers for the table | |
headers = ['Nume', 'Prenume', 'Titlu', 'Editura', 'Cota', 'Pret', 'An'] | |
# Unified excel name | |
workbook_name = input('Unified Workbook name ') | |
book = Workbook() | |
sheet = book.active | |
# Specify path | |
path = input('Path: ') | |
# Get all files from folder | |
files = os.listdir(path) | |
for file in files: | |
rows = reader(file) | |
for row in rows: | |
sheet.append(row) | |
book.save(filename=workbook_name) |
